All-Terrain Stroller - What You Need to Know

All-terrain strollers are ideal for parents who want to take an extended walk through the countryside, or go for a jog. They come with air-filled or foam-filled tyres to handle bumpy surfaces, and good suspension to make the ride comfortable for toddlers or babies.

These pushchairs also have excellent features for parents, such as one-handed folding, an adjustable handlebars, and a parent or world facing seating positions. They also have plenty of storage.

Easy to maneuver

An all-terrain stroller is a fantastic option for parents who love to go on family walks that take them off-road. These kinds of buggies are usually designed with larger wheels that can handle bumps and lumps better and have excellent suspension for a smooth ride. They are available in a variety of colours and styles and you can pick one that suits your preferences. Some all terrain strollers are also jogging-ready, making them even more versatile.

The biggest puncture-proof wheel is probably the most important aspect of a pram that can take on any terrain. Many of them come with two larger back tyres and one smaller front tyre which means they can withstand rough terrain. They are also easy to maneuver around kerbs as they can be controlled by one hand. Some models come with a lockable swivel for the front wheel that gives you more control when driving on rough surfaces.

All-terrain prams are usually equipped with air-filled tires that give a smooth ride on different surfaces. They are more prone to abrasion so it's worth looking for models that feature replaceable tyres or puncture-proof ones. You won't have to carry around a puncture kit.

Mums who have tested the Cybex Avi found it to be a great choice for all types of terrain. Its wide smooth tires are able to handle different types of terrain, and its hand steering makes it simple to maneuver. It's only downside is it's longer and wider than other prams. You may have trouble fitting it into narrow aisles.

Other all-terrain options include the Bugaboo Fox 5 and the Thule Urban Glide 2. Both have a large front wheel, puncture-proof, and suspension to provide smooth riding. The Urban Glide 2 is also an excellent choice for jogging, and comes with a lockable front swivel as well as 16'' air-filled tyres and a twist handbrake. It can be folded to a small size that is ideal for travel, and should be accepted on airlines like EasyJet.

The Mamas & Papas Ocarro, another all-terrain option is also a huge hit. It has a simple, one-hand fold and a big basket, as well as being comfortable for your child. It's a little heavier than some other pushchairs that are all-terrain however it's a great option for parents who plan to use it in a hilly regions.

Comfortable for your child

All terrain strollers are great for taking your child on any adventure. It's designed to move across rough terrain and is made of high-quality materials that will keep your child comfy. You can also use it to transport a car seat or baby carrier. You can pick from a wide range of colors and styles, so you'll be able to find the ideal stroller that can be used on all terrains for your family.

All-terrain strollers come with large wheels that let them be used on a variety of surfaces. They also feature suspension that makes them a pleasant ride for your baby. They are also lightweight and easy to carry around.

If you are looking for an all-terrain buggy, look for one with 3 or more large swivel wheels and a lockable wheel at the front. They are puncture-proof, which means you don't need to worry about carrying a spare tire with your. Some models have hand brakes to provide safety and control.

The UPPAbaby Ridge is an all-terrain stroller that's suitable for infants to toddlers. It can be used as a transport system that includes a baby car seat (adaptors included). It has some brilliant features, including an enormous basket, a zippered pocket on the hood and a pop-out eyeshade. The cushioned seat is padded without looking heavy, and it reclines to a full lie-flat position. However, it does lack an upright bolt that parents might prefer.

Another great all-terrain pushchair model is the Thule Shine. The compact and lightweight model comes with a large basket and is suitable for jogging too. It can accommodate a baby car seat or infant carrier, and comes with one-step fold that is incredibly easy to do. It comes with a simple handbrake that helps to avoid injuries that can result from accidentally hitting the brake.

If you're looking for a stroller that can be used on all terrains and also be used as a travel buggie, the Baby Jogger Summit or Elite might be the perfect choice for you. These are designed to handle all types of terrain, and come with a three-point harness that ensures your child's safety when traveling.

An all-terrain stroller must be easy to clean, especially after muddy walks. A damp cloth and a handheld vacuum cleaner are your ideal friends for this. These features will ensure that your buggy stays tidy and in good condition for your outings.

Many all-terrain pushchairs strollers use air-filled wheels similar to those found on bicycles. These provide smoother rides on rough surfaces, but they could be prone to punctures. There are all terrain travel system-terrain strollers that have tires that are low maintenance, composed of foam or other materials.

Versatile

The best stroller for rough terrain all-terrain strollers will have many features that are suitable for your lifestyle. Some models will come with extra-padded seats, a larger basket, and zip pockets on the hood. These models also have puncture-proof tires, so you can drive on rough terrain without fearing flats. Some models even have a lockable front swivel which can assist you in maneuvering around obstacles. They are also smaller than traditional prams and take up less room in your home or car.

If you're looking for a stroller that can withstand the toughest surfaces and rough conditions, you should consider an all-terrain pushchair. These pushchairs have large wheels that can be used on various of surfaces, including cobblestones and woodland trails. They can also be used on muddy fields. They also have excellent suspension to ensure a smooth ride for your baby.

Out N About, a company based in the UK is a renowned brand in all-terrain strollers. Its Nipper V5 is a fantastic option. Its all-wheel suspension and large air-filled tyres make it a ideal choice for rough terrain as well as its user-friendly brake system and easy folding mechanism make it a great travel companion.

Another excellent all-terrain pushchair is the Mamas & Papas Ocarro. It folds up compactly with one hand and used with an infant car seat or a carrycot. The seat is suitable for use from birth and is able to be used in a flat position. It also comes with a large storage basket that is ideal to store all the things you need for outdoor adventures.

The Thule Urban Glide 2 is an additional excellent all-terrain stroller with many impressive features. It comes with a huge basket and ergonomic handle as well as an adjustable height handlebar. It has a locking front wheel that swivels and an easy-to-use brake control. It also has reflectors on the canopy and wheels which are useful if you are going to be out at night.

The Mountain Buggy XT premium jogger is a combination of precise steering, high control, and stylish styling for active parenting. It also has top-of-the-line manoeuvrability. It's also extremely lightweight, and has large 16" air-filled wheels and great suspension.
